    Natural Law and Natural Rights (1980; second edition 2011) is a book by John Finnis first published by Oxford University Press, as part of the Clarendon Law Series.Finnis develops a philosophy of Law in the tradition of Aristotle and Thomas Aquinas – Natural Law.
